Lets compare vitamin content per 5 ounces of Cookies, peanut butter, commercially prepared, soft-type vs Canned Carrots with Liquids and Salt:
- 5 ounces of Cookies, peanut butter, commercially prepared, soft-type have 13.1 times more Vitamin B1, 6.1 times more Vitamin B2, 5.1 times more Vitamin B3, 2.6 times more Vitamin B5 and 8.4 times more Vitamin B9 than Canned Carrots with Liquids and Salt.
- While 5 oz of Canned Carrots Solids and Liquids with Salt contain more Vitamin A, 4.1 times more Vitamin B6 and more Vitamin C than Cookies, peanut butter, commercially prepared, soft-type.
- 5 ounces of Cookies, peanut butter, commercially prepared, soft-type have insufficient amounts of Vitamin A and Vitamin C
- 5 ounces of Canned Carrots with Liquids and Salt have insufficient amounts of Vitamin B1
- Both Cookies, peanut butter, commercially prepared, soft-type as well as Canned Carrots Solids and Liquids with Salt have insufficient amounts of Vitamin B12 in five ounces.
Comparing minerals per 5 ounces for Cookies, peanut butter, commercially prepared, soft-type vs Canned Carrots with Liquids and Salt:
- 5 ounces of Cookies, peanut butter, commercially prepared, soft-type have 1.7 times more Iron, 3.6 times more Magnesium, 4.4 times more Phosphorus, 11 times more Selenium, 1.4 times more Sodium and 1.9 times more Zinc than Canned Carrots with Liquids and Salt.
- While 5 oz of Canned Carrots Solids and Liquids with Salt contain 2.6 times more Calcium, 1.3 times more Copper, 1.6 times more Potassium and 8.1 times more Water than Cookies, peanut butter, commercially prepared, soft-type.
- Both Cookies, peanut butter, commercially prepared, soft-type and Canned Carrots with Liquids and Salt contain similar levels of Manganese per five ounces.
- 5 ounces of Cookies, peanut butter, commercially prepared, soft-type lack sufficient amounts of Calcium
- 5 ounces of Canned Carrots with Liquids and Salt lack sufficient amounts of Selenium
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 5 ounces:
- 5 ounces of Cookies, peanut butter, commercially prepared, soft-type have 19.9 times more Energy, 174.3 times more Fat, 246 times more Saturated Fat, 14.1 times more Omega 3, 75.8 times more Omega 6, 10.7 times more Carbohydrate and 9.1 times more Protein than Canned Carrots with Liquids and Salt.
- Both Cookies, peanut butter, commercially prepared, soft-type and Canned Carrots with Liquids and Salt offer comparable quantities of Fiber per five ounces.
- 5 ounces of Canned Carrots with Liquids and Salt provide inadequate amounts of Energy, Omega 3, Omega 6 and Protein
